Transaction 54d3f689f71da8eec305a4f10359a7397c675442b626d2e7d4013c01d383ef6a
1 Input
1 Output
-
54d3f689f71da8eec305a4f10359a7397c675442b626d2e7d4013c01d383ef6a:0
- value
- 12543602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3e505db0f7253ed7639ea3c62ad8c1414364121 OP_EQUAL
- address
- MQJMYZCu7ddsuyDct3irpSS8rGRPg2AKt9